But here is some hard evidence for you:
Racist:
You could charge foreigners interest, but you could not charge a fellow Jew interest. Deuteronomy 23:19-20.
You could own a foreign slave indefinitely (Leviticus 25:44-46), but you could only own a Jew slave for 6 years (Exodus 21:2).
Jesus refers to gentiles as dogs. Matthew 15:22-28.
Sexist:
I won't even bother explaining these verses.
Genesis 3:16. 1 Corinthians 14:34-35. Leviticus 12:2-5.
Genocidal:
How about the entire book of Joshua? Or if that's too much, read chapter 10.
Slave-driving:
You may beat your slaves as long as you don't kill them or cause permanent injury. Exodus 21:20-27.
Slaves are regarded as property and may be passed down as inheritance. Leviticus 25:44-46.
Rapists:
Deuteronomy 22:28-29.
